The Evolution of a Goblin to the Peak

The fantasy VRMMORPG, Battle Worlds, is one of the most played games in the world. In this game, there's a legendary player that could defeat a "Boss" on his own. His name is Blood(In-Game-Name). Blood is a legendary player that surpassed all the players in the world. He completed hundreds of quests and dungeon raids alone. When Blood was going to log off, suddenly the virtual capsule that he was wearing exploded causing him to die. His soul didn't go to the cycle of reincarnation but it was sucked by something causing him to transmigrate into a body of Goblin. This is a story about a boy that was transmigrated in the body of a Goblin. Follow him as he rises through the ranks and become the most powerful monster in the world. ....... Advancement Exam

Souta was standing in front of the Adventurers Guild. Behind him were the members of the Dark Oculus and Lanny group. They were here to watch him and support him in his advancement exam.

"I didn't think that you would try to become a B-rank at this moment, captain," Ginvi said from the side as he combed his mohawk style green hair.

"Yeah, but I think you'll pass the exam without any problem, captain," Jagret said.

"Yohoo! I wanna take the exam too!" Bryan said with an excited expression.

"It's too early for you Bryan. Come back if you have the same power as the captain." Brando said to Bryan while shaking his head.

"Brother Souta! Good luck! I'm cheering for you!" Cluster said as she raised both of her hands in the air.

Souta smiled and said, "Let's go." before he entered inside the guild building with the rest of his comrades. During the past two days, his skill had grown. He could feel that his sword skill was improving with Saya's tutelage.
